Title :
Application of Adaptive Filtering Based on Harmonic Wavelet in the Dynamic Unbalance of Electro-Spindle

Abstract :
In order to adapt to high accuracy test requirement of dynamic balancing of Electric spindle. According to the harmonic wavelet phase locked, narrow-band analysis and the clear expression in time-domain, the method and algorithm of adaptive filtering based on harmonic wavelet was given. This method in accordance with the signal correlation, the dynamic unbalance signal was extracted by the relevant operation between harmonic wavelet and the vibration signal in time domain. The study of simulation and on-site dynamic balance test for electric spindle is done, the results show that: through adaptive filtering based on harmonic wavelet, the dynamic unbalance signal can be extracted accurately. This filtering method is simple and good in real-time, it can be adapted to the requirement of high-precision dynamic balancing measurement of spindle with rotating speed variation, and it has better applied value.
